I ordered the Salmon BLT(without the bacon), garlic fries and a drink. It came to about $ 20. Overall, the food is good here and the service is great. The portions are huge and the food is fresh. Menu: They offer a nice variety for any burger-lover. They have cool spins on veggie, beef, chicken, turkey, lamb, salmon, tuna and pulled pork burgers. They have plenty of toppings to add on and you can add a side salad, traditional or sweet potato fries, grilled asparagus or onion rings. They also offer a few other options for kids like hotdogs and chicken tenders. You can get shakes here as well. Food: This is probably my second time having food from here. Today is was a little underwhelming. The ice machine wasn’t working so I had to drink room-temperature tea lol. My garlic fries had GREAT flavor and they give you whole roasted cloves of garlic! This made me happy! But they weren’t hot :-(They were almost cold. My salmon burger had great flavor but was missing something. Maybe the bacon? Im not sure. But they do give you two freshly grilled salmon steaks, not patties, so the food is fresh and they don’t skimp on the portions. I’d come back. Location: It’s located on a busy street and parking is extremely limited, but it’s within walking distance of the metro.
